9/2/11 - MTI Launches Updated Funding Program and New Locations
MTI is pleased to announce updates to its funding program for business innovation in Maine that we have been finalizing through the summer months. The changes have been motivated by the lessons that we have learned and program evaluation data from MTI's years of supporting innovation and entrepreneurship in Maine, the evolving economic and investment conditions facing Maine companies as they work to grow and innovate, and our continued efforts to be a high-performing, cost-effective organization stewarding public support in a way that best meets the needs of Maine's technology-based businesses. The goal is to create greater access to coaching and capital for growing businesses from Maine's traditional industries to Maine's emerging industries.
Here is an outline of the changes. Further details can be found on the MTI website.
NEW TechStart Grants for up to $5,000, which will be awarded on a monthly basis for concept planning, market research and tech transfer exploration.
REVISED Seed Grants of up to $25,000, which will now be available every four months for early-stage R&D activity.
REVISED Development Loans that will lend up to $500,000 as a conditional loan for later stage R&D activity.
NEW Business Accelerator Grants for activities that will increase a company's chance of success such as business planning, strengthening financial management capacity, developing strategies to secure key customers, strategic partners and investors and entrepreneurship training for management. Eligible Maine companies will be those that have received federal Small Business Innovation Research grants and first-time entrepreneurs who have been awarded an MTI Development Loan.
EXPANDED Equity Capital to make investments up to $200,000 available for selected MTI recipient companies that need to achieve specific milestones to secure follow-on private investment.
A full schedule of workshops and webinars to introduce the new funding program begins on September 8 with a workshop at the Target Technology Center in Orono. Details can be found here.
In addition to the core funding updates, MTI is increasing access to businesses across the state in a number of ways. Beginning on September 8, MTI will hold monthly office days at the Target Technology Center in Orono on the first Thursday of every month. Later in September, MTI will be moving its main office in Gardiner to the Brunswick Landing in Brunswick. These will complement our periodic workshops held across the state.
